This book is aimed at musicians and people who wish to find out what all the fuss is about MP3s. It briefely covers some of the theory behind MP3 technology, but is mostly a practical guide on how to get those tunes playing. Musicians can learn how to use MP3s to reach a wider audience (and possibly do it profitably). Andy Rathbone has extensive experience of MP3s and has included numerous useful tips that only one with insider knowledge could have gained. One problem with a book on this subject is that the technology is moving so fast that the software / hardware covered in the book is very rapidly out of date. This is not a book for people who wish to have an up to date reference guide for state of the art MP3 technology. It is, however, a very good book for those looking for a practical guide on how to start listening to MP3s.
